(KENORA DISTRICT, ON) - The Kenora Detachment of the Ontario Provincial Police (OPP) has charged one individual after responding to a break and enter.
On Tuesday, July 7, 2026, shortly after 11:00 pm CT, officers responded to a break and enter call for service at a cabin on Pistol Lake.
As a result of an investigation, Shandi DIAZ-LOPEZ, 24 years old from Wabaseemoong First Nation, was arrested and charged with the following Criminal Code offence:
- Break, enter a dwelling house with intent to commit indictable offence
The accused remains in custody and is scheduled to appear before the Ontario Court of Justice in Kenora on Thursday, July 9, 2026.
